Has anyone used Nextlink Esim in the USA? by TheOracle722 in eSIMs

[–]TheOracle722[S] 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I did and it was excellent. I had 5G NSA on T-mobile my entire stay all the way from Atlanta to Gainesville Florida. Speeds were between 250-450mbps. My phone is a Redmi Note 13 Pro 5G.

My only mistake was buying far too much data for a 10 day trip as I only used about 4.5gb out of 30gb as there's free wifi everywhere and 1gb of that was testing the speed.

Note: my usage was a lot of Google maps, Whatsapp calls/videos/pics, YouTube and Google Voice calls. Browsing consisted mostly of ordering stuff from Walmart, DoorDash etc. I briefly tried my iptv provider and it worked great without needing my vpn.

Onn 4k Plus Setup- Google Accounts by Anonymous-BatDude in AndroidTV

[–]TheOracle722 -1 points0 points  (0 children)

  1. You don't need to enable Developer Options to sideload on Android.

  2. You don't need the Downloader app to sideload on Android. Download TV Bro from the Playstore and use Firestickhacks dot com.

  3. You can remove your account and the installed apps will remain but you will lose paid status on apps you've paid for.

  4. You can retain your account and lock it after adding his account. That's what I did for a relation last week when I set up a box for him. There's a paid app installed that needs my account to operate properly.

Audio issue by dnoonan52 in OnnStreamingDevice

[–]TheOracle722 0 points1 point  (0 children)

It seems this started with the August update. Switching off Audio Pass Through fixed it for some. In my case it was already off and I switched off CEC to solve it.
